Ludlow Village Inn & Suites is located in Ludlow, VT. This is the only Ludlow Village Inn & Suites location in Ludlow.
Loading Map of Ludlow Village Inn & Suites. Please wait...
To lookup step by step driving directions to Ludlow Village Inn & Suites, please enter your starting Address:
You can use this Form to TXT this place to an SMS capable phone:
Please call (802) 228-8686 for check in and check out times.
We do not have the Payment Methods Accepted at this place. Most places accept Cash and Major Credit Cards. Please contact Ludlow Village Inn & Suites at (802) 228-8686 to find out payment options & Other details.
Here is a list of Hotels & Motels close to Ludlow Village Inn & Suites. View all Hotels & Motels in Ludlow, or Hotels & Motels in Zip code 05149.
93 Main St, Ludlow, VT-05149 (802) 228-8188
101 Main St, Ludlow, VT-05149 (802) 228-8363
85 Main St, Ludlow, VT-05149 (802) 228-5769
112 Main St, Ludlow, VT-05149 (802) 228-8100
13 Pleasant St, Ludlow, VT-05149 (802) 228-4846